Question about rear Spoiler?
Hello Everyone!
My father and i are trying to remove the rear spoiler on his RX400h. I am visiting my parents in Russia and my father decided to replace the brake light in the spoiler. A few weeks ago he was backing out of the garage and hit the top of the door that has not retracted all the way yet. He is used to driving his GS450h that is much lower. He ended up scratching the spoiler and busting the brake light.
There is really no need to remove the spoiler to replace the light but one of the bolts that holds the spoiler is stripped and totally rusted to the spoiler. We want to remove the spoiler and try to remove the bolt.
We got all the bolts loose but the spoiler is still connected somewhere.
If anyone has a diagram of where the bolts are please help us out.

Rear Center Lamp
You will have to remove the spoiler to get to the bolt you are talking about. The spoiler is bolted from the inside. You will have to remove all the garnish to get to the bolts.
Remove back door trim board.
Remove back window panel trim.
Remove back door trim cover, left and right.
Remove bolts.

We figured it out. The spoiler has two plastic prongs that hold it in place when all the bolts are taken out. So we just pulled on it harder and it poped off. The garnish is all on clips. You just pull on it and it comes off. Dont be afraid they are very strong.
